lineal consanguinity

Read a random definition: omissa et male appretiata

A quick definition of lineal consanguinity:

Lineal consanguinity refers to the blood relationship between people who are direct descendants or ascendants of each other. This means that they are related in a direct line, like a father, son, and grandson. It can go downwards, like from a son to a grandson, or upwards, like from a son to a father and grandfather.

A more thorough explanation:

Lineal consanguinity refers to the blood relationship between individuals where one is a direct descendant or ascendant of the other. This means that they are related in a direct line, such as between a father, son, and grandson.

For example, if we consider a father, his son, and his grandson, they are related by lineal consanguinity. The father is the direct ascendant of the son, and the son is the direct ascendant of the grandson. Similarly, if we consider a son, his father, and his grandfather, they are related by lineal consanguinity. The son is the direct descendant of the father, and the father is the direct descendant of the grandfather.

Lineal consanguinity can either be downward in a direct descending line or upward in a direct ascending line. In a descending line, the relationship is between a person and their direct descendants, such as a father, son, and grandson. In an ascending line, the relationship is between a person and their direct ascendants, such as a son, father, and grandfather.

Lineal consanguinity is an important concept in genealogy and family law, as it determines the degree of relationship between individuals and can have legal implications in matters such as inheritance and marriage.
